What parents usually need to know about expired car seat insurance coverage

Insurance questions about expired car seats can be confusing because coverage often depends on the policy, the type of accident, the adjuster’s documentation requirements, and whether the seat was in use or damaged in the crash. In many cases, insurers replace car seats after a collision, but an expired seat can create extra questions about reimbursement, value, and whether replacement is still covered. What can strengthen an expired car seat insurance claim

Clear crash details

Keep the date of loss, claim number, photos, and a short description of where the car seat was installed and how the crash happened. This can help when discussing an expired car seat claim after crash.

Seat information

Have the brand, model, manufacture date, expiration date, and any visible damage ready. Even when a seat is expired, insurers may still ask for full product details before deciding on reimbursement.

Replacement rationale

If you are seeking insurance reimbursement for expired car seat replacement, it helps to explain why the seat cannot continue to be used and what replacement cost you are requesting.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does car insurance cover an expired car seat after an accident?

Sometimes, but it depends on the insurer, the policy, and the circumstances of the crash. Some companies replace car seats involved in collisions, while others may question coverage if the seat was already expired. Documentation and the insurer’s crash replacement standards often matter.

Can I file an insurance claim for an expired car seat?

You may be able to file a claim, especially if the expired car seat was in the vehicle during the crash and now needs replacement. Whether the claim is approved can depend on the policy terms, the adjuster’s review, and the information you provide about the seat and the accident.

Will insurance pay for an expired car seat if there is no visible damage?

Possibly. Some insurers consider crash involvement itself enough to justify replacement, while others focus more heavily on visible damage or specific crash severity criteria. An expired seat can add complexity, so it helps to gather the insurer’s written requirements.

What should I provide for an expired car seat insurance claim?

Useful information often includes the claim number, crash date, seat brand and model, manufacture and expiration dates, photos, and any visible damage. If you are requesting reimbursement, a replacement cost estimate may also help.

Does auto insurance cover expired car seat damage the same way as a non-expired seat?

Not always. A non-expired seat may fit more easily within an insurer’s standard replacement process. With an expired seat, the insurer may raise questions about value, prior usability, or whether reimbursement is still appropriate after the crash.
